Can't open email attachments in windows 10
Frustrating! Don't worry, I'm here to help you troubleshoot the issue. Here are some steps to help you open email attachments in Windows 10:
1. Check your email client settings:
- Ensure that your email client (e.g., Outlook, Gmail, Yahoo Mail) is configured correctly.
- Check if the attachment is enabled in your email client's settings.
2. Update your email client:
- Make sure your email client is updated to the latest version.
- Sometimes, updates can resolve issues like this.
3. Check your Windows 10 settings:
- Go to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Security > Virus & threat protection.
- Ensure that Real-time protection is turned on.
- If you have a third-party antivirus software, try disabling it temporarily to see if it's interfering with attachment opening.
4. Check your file associations:
- Go to Settings > Apps > Default apps > Choose default apps by file type.
- Ensure that the file type associated with the attachment (e.g.,.docx,.pdf) is set to the correct program (e.g., Microsoft Word, Adobe Reader).
5. Check for corrupted files:
- Try downloading the attachment again to ensure it's not corrupted.
- If the attachment is still corrupted, contact the sender to request a new copy.
6. Disable any third-party add-ons:
- If you have any third-party add-ons or extensions installed in your email client, try disabling them to see if they're causing the issue.
7. Reset your email client:
- If none of the above steps work, try resetting your email client to its default settings.
8. Check for Windows 10 updates:
- Ensure that your Windows 10 is updated to the latest version.
- Sometimes, updates can resolve issues like this.
9. Contact your email provider:
- If none of the above steps work, contact your email provider's support team for further assistance.
